Eating Healthy at Pappadeaux: Tips and Tricks

Navigating a menu as rich and tempting as Pappadeaux’s might seem daunting for those of us trying to stick to a healthier diet. However, with a bit of know-how and strategic decision-making, it’s entirely possible to enjoy a meal that’s both delicious and aligned with your health goals. Here are some actionable tips and tricks to help you dine healthily at Pappadeaux:

  1. Start Light: Begin with a broth-based soup or a salad with dressing on the side. This can help control hunger and reduce the likelihood of overeating.
  2. Grilled over Fried: Whenever possible, choose dishes that are grilled, baked, or steamed. These cooking methods retain the natural flavors of the food without adding unnecessary fats and calories.
  3. Mind the Sides: Swap out heavier sides like fries or creamy mashed potatoes for steamed vegetables or a side salad. This simple switch can save hundreds of calories.
  4. Portion Control: Be mindful of the generous portion sizes. Consider sharing an entree with a dining partner or asking for a box to take half of your meal home for later.
  5. Special Requests: Don’t hesitate to ask for modifications. Requesting no butter or sauce on the side can make a significant difference in the nutritional value of your meal.
  6. Stay Hydrated: Choose water or unsweetened beverages to accompany your meal. This can help avoid unnecessary calories from sugary drinks or alcoholic beverages.

How to Navigate Restaurant Menus for Better Health

Dining out is a delightful experience, but it often presents a challenge for those trying to maintain a healthy diet. Whether at Pappadeaux or any other restaurant, understanding how to navigate the menu can make a significant difference in your dining choices. Here are some universal tips for making healthier selections:

  1. Look for Keywords: Menu descriptions can give clues about the preparation of a dish. Words like “grilled,” “baked,” “steamed,” or “raw” often indicate healthier options, whereas “fried,” “battered,” “creamy,” or “breaded” suggest higher calorie content.
  2. Ask Questions: If you’re unsure about the ingredients or preparation methods of a dish, don’t hesitate to ask your server for more information.
  3. Balance Your Meal: Aim for a balance of macronutrients by including a source of lean protein, healthy fats, and fiber from vegetables or whole grains in your meal.
  4. Control Portions: Be conscious of portion sizes, which are frequently larger than standard serving sizes. You can share a dish or ask for a portion to be boxed up early to avoid overeating.
  5. Mindful of Add-ons: Toppings and sides, such as dressings, sauces, or cheese, can quickly increase a meal’s calorie count. Opt for these items on the side or request them sparingly.

Applying these strategies can help you make more informed and health-conscious decisions, allowing you to enjoy the dining experience without compromising your dietary goals.

What are the calorie counts for popular Pappadeaux dishes?

Understanding the calorie counts of popular dishes at Pappadeaux can help you make informed decisions about what to order based on your dietary needs and goals. While specific calorie information can vary based on portion size and preparation, here’s a general guide to the calorie content of some beloved Pappadeaux dishes, along with tips for how these selections fit into a balanced diet:

  1. Fried Alligator: A favorite appetizer, a small plate of fried alligator can range from 300 to 500 calories, depending on the serving size. Opting for a shared portion can help manage intake.
  2. Seafood Gumbo: A cup of seafood gumbo may contain about 230-300 calories. Choosing a cup over a bowl can keep your calorie count lower, allowing room to enjoy a main course.
  3. Grilled Shrimp & Grits: This hearty dish can range from 600 to 800 calories. Considering the rich nature of grits, you might want to balance this with lighter choices throughout the day.
  4. Blackened Catfish with Dirty Rice: A single serving of this flavorful entrée can be around 700-900 calories. To reduce this, you could ask for a half portion or substitute the dirty rice with a less calorie-dense side, like steamed vegetables.
  5. Stuffed Crab: A stuffed crab entree, with sides, can easily reach 800-1000 calories. Choosing a vegetable side and skipping creamy sauces can help mitigate this.
  6. Oysters Pappadeaux (half dozen): This appetizer is relatively lower in calories, with about 150-200 calories per half dozen, making it a good starter choice.
  7. Crispy Salmon with Roasted Red Potatoes: A full plate can be around 900-1100 calories. To enjoy this dish more healthily, consider sharing or saving half for later.
  8. Pappadeaux Platter: This fried seafood platter is one of the highest calorie options, often exceeding 1500 calories. Opting for grilled seafood platter versions, when available, or sharing the dish can help manage calorie intake.

Can I find gluten-free options at Pappadeaux?

Yes, Pappadeaux Seafood Kitchen offers a variety of gluten-free options for those with gluten sensitivities or celiac disease, ensuring that everyone can enjoy their dining experience without worry. Navigating a gluten-free diet can be challenging, especially when dining out, but Pappadeaux makes it easier by providing a selection of dishes that cater to this dietary requirement. Here are some strategies and options for a gluten-free meal at Pappadeaux:

  1. Communicate with Your Server: Before ordering, inform your server of your gluten sensitivity or celiac disease. They can guide you to the gluten-free options available and communicate with the kitchen to ensure your meal is prepared safely.
  2. Gluten-Free Starters: Look for appetizers like oysters on the half shell, shrimp cocktail, or a seafood salad without croutons. These can be great starters that are naturally gluten-free.
  3. Seafood Entrees: Many of Pappadeaux’s seafood dishes can be prepared gluten-free, especially those that are grilled, broiled, or steamed. Dishes like grilled fish, shrimp, and lobster tail can be safe choices, but always confirm with the server that no gluten-containing ingredients are used in the preparation.
  4. Salads: Salads can be a good option, but it’s important to ask for no croutons and to check that the dressings are gluten-free. Some dressings may contain gluten, so requesting olive oil and vinegar or a gluten-free dressing is a safer choice.
  5. Side Dishes: Steamed vegetables, mashed potatoes (ensure they’re made without flour), and certain rice dishes can be suitable gluten-free sides. Again, verify with your server to ensure these are prepared without any gluten-containing ingredients.
  6. Special Requests: Don’t hesitate to ask for modifications to a dish to make it gluten-free. The kitchen can often accommodate requests such as leaving out a sauce or substituting a gluten-containing side with a gluten-free alternative.
  7. Avoid Cross-Contamination: Ensure that the kitchen is aware of the need to avoid cross-contamination with gluten-containing foods. This includes using clean cooking surfaces, utensils, and cookware.

It’s worth noting that while Pappadeaux strives to accommodate guests with dietary restrictions, the risk of cross-contamination in a busy kitchen cannot be entirely eliminated. Guests with severe gluten sensitivities or celiac disease should consider their level of sensitivity when dining out and communicate their needs clearly to the restaurant staff.

Enjoying a gluten-free meal at Pappadeaux is quite feasible with a bit of planning and communication. By choosing naturally gluten-free foods like fresh seafood and vegetables and asking the right questions, you can have a safe and enjoyable dining experience.
